The leading blank lines are apparently an artefact of an older source
control system. They are not required and they look like accidents,
because starting a source file with a blank line is not a regular habit
of software developers nowadays.

In the previous commit 9e538750d99c8f1accf7e93878e4fde47c069908
we removed the obsolete assembler implementation `filter_neon.S`.
In this commit we add a stand-in for the original file, restoring
the original source tree structure, for the benefit of continuing
hassle-free libpng source upgrades in the 1.6.x line.
This file contains hand-coded assembler implementations of the filter
functions for 32-bit Arm platforms. These are only used when the
compiler doesn't support neon intrinsics (added to GCC 4.3 in 2008) or
is exactly GCC 4.5.4 (released 2012), both of which are sufficiently
unlikely to be true that it's fair to say the assembler is no longer
used.
This commit deletes filter_neon.S and removes the now obsolete
preprocessor logic in pngpriv.h.
